Expected learning outcomes
Knowledge:
Students will be able to explain:
- Thermodynamics 1 and 2 law and how they affect us
- How gas laws work
- How humid air diagram may be used.
- How the heat transfer between the gas, liquid and solids takes place and means
Skills:
Students will gain the skills to:
- Calculate mixtures of airflows of different amount and quality
- Calculate a steam turbine process in a step
- Compute such required chimney height provided a combustion volume
- Calculate circuit processes for piston machines
- Calculate the heat transfer in various substances
- Calculate the temperatures and flow rates at different air mixtures
General competence:
- Have an opinion about what efficiency is and can relate to them.
- Know the difference between energy and power,
- May participate in discussions on an elementary level regarding energy and heat in the process and comfort heating
Topic(s)
- Basic thermodynamics
- Heat Transfer
- Moist air
- Water vapor thermodynamics
- Vapour Processes
- Combustion and purification
- Refrigeration and Heat Pump Processes
